English dictionary

musculus sphincter urethrae meaning and definition

Definition and meaning of musculus sphincter urethrae at MeaningMonkey.org. musculus sphincter urethrae meaning and definition in the English Dictionary.

MUSCULUS SPHINCTER URETHRAE noun

Definition of musculus sphincter urethrae (noun)

  1. a striated sphincter muscle that constricts the urethra
Source: Princeton University Wordnet

If you find this page useful, share it with others! It would be a great help. Thank you!

  

Link to this page: